As follow up for the blog post “Run tests for OXID eShop 6” here’s how to get module tests running for OXID eShop 6.
About Heike Reuter
"Software Developer at OXID eSales since 2007.
Interested in computer sciences, eCommerce, hand spinning, cardweaving and other handicrafts. Cannot live without online shops. Raising the next generation of computer addicts (mother of twins)."
Entries by Heike Reuter
Nice thing about OXID eShop, they provide a development environment. Without big effort you can get have the shop up and running on a virtual machine. The current blog post will give some hints for how to run the shop tests that come with the shop. We will cover how to run module tests in a follow up post.
This post describes the minimum changes necessary to make an existing module immediately compatible with OXID eShop 6.0. In a later blog post we will tell you how to fully port a module or write a new one from scratch so that it fits OXID eShop 6.0 and above.
OXID eShop versions 6.0.0 beta was published containing many changes “under the hood”. Read this blog post for the release notes.
Namespaces With the namespaces we introduced new namespaced classes for all former oxSomething classes. The old oxSomething classes have all been marked as deprecated as of V6.0 (@deprecated on b-dev), have no more content and extend their new namespaced analogon. For backwards compatibility, classMap.php has been introduced, which ensures that the usage of all oxSomething […]
We found a nasty little bug in conjunction with MySQL 5.6 setting “block_nested_loop” and OXID eShop Enterprise Edition 5.2.x. Please learn in this blog post how it looks like and how to work around.